> The PTX backend we developed (CBackend approach, does not use the target
> independent code generator) is already more advanced.
> An older version is published here:
> http://sourceforge.net/projects/llvmptxbackend/
>
> We recently eliminated a bug which increased the number of required
> registers per thread. Surprisingly, without that bug the generated code is
> already comparable to code generated by the official nvcc copiler.  Of cause
> the nvcc compiler is superior in a lot of cases, however only by a small
> margin. And there are even cases(e.g. a phong surface shader) where our PTX
> backend is faster, without any particular optimization! It seems like the
> NVIDIA driver does a good job at late optimizations liker register
> allocation etc. I can give you some numbers if you are intrested.
> I'll push the newest version of the backend to sourceforge during the next
> days.
>
> What kind of optimizations are you planning to do? If you want to apply
> high level (on llvm bitcode) optimizations, you can start with our PTX
> backend and shwitch over to the new backend approach later on (If it turns
> out that the new approach is really faster).
